在当今这个信息时代,网络安全问题日益凸显,尤其是在互联网应用中,密码作为用户身份验证的重要手段,其安全性至关重要。在JSP(Java Server Pages)开发中,如何判断用户输入的密码是否与数据库中存储的密码一致,是一个常见的需求。本文将为大家详细介绍jsp判断密码是否一致实例,帮助大家轻松实现密码验证功能。

一、背景介绍

jsp判断密码是否一致实例_jsp中对账号密码进行判断  第1张

在Web应用中,用户注册、登录等功能都需要进行密码验证。为了保证用户账户的安全性,我们需要验证用户输入的密码是否与数据库中存储的密码一致。以下是一个简单的场景:

1. 用户在注册或登录页面输入用户名和密码。

2. 服务器端接收到用户提交的信息,通过JSP代码对用户名和密码进行验证。

3. 验证成功后,允许用户登录或注册;验证失败,提示用户密码错误。

二、实现步骤

下面以一个简单的JSP实例来展示如何判断密码是否一致。

1. 创建数据库表

我们需要在数据库中创建一个用于存储用户信息的表,例如用户表(user)。以下是创建表的SQL语句:

```sql

CREATE TABLE user (

id INT PRIMARY KEY AUTO_INCREMENT,

username VARCHAR(50),

password VARCHAR(50)

);

```

2. 创建用户注册页面

在Web项目中创建一个名为`register.jsp`的页面,用于用户注册。页面中包含用户名和密码输入框,以及提交按钮。

```jsp

<%@ page language="